Quiz Answer Key and Fun Facts
1. This dreamer could say that he fell asleep, lost a rib and gained a wife. Who would have thought it could be that easy?

Answer: Adam

Genesis 2:20-22 tells of how God provided man with a "suitable helper" in this peculiar way.
2. Which of these dreamers wanted to put to death all of his wise men because they couldn't interpret his dream?

Answer: Nebuchadnezzar

Talk about being intense! King Nebuchadnezzar ordered the astrologers to give not only interpretations of his dream, but they also had to tell him what he had dreamed in the first place. When they couldn't do it he ordered them all executed. See Daniel 2:12.
3. Which young man was hated by his brothers because of some dreams he had?

Answer: Joseph

See Genesis 37:1-11. Joseph's brothers really didn't appreciate him telling them about the dreams in which they were bowing before him. They thought he was just being fanciful, but they didn't know that it was a foretelling of days to come.
4. Who had an awful dream about thin cows eating fat cows?

Answer: Pharaoh

Joseph interpreted Pharaoh's dream and let him know about the seven years of famine that would strike the land. See Genesis 41:4.
5. Talk about needing new bodyguards! While this king slept, his enemy was able to get close to him, steal his weapon and water jug and get away without anyone noticing. Who was this heavy sleeper?

Answer: Saul

1 Samuel 26:12 tells of how David was able to get into Saul's camp without being noticed. The verse says the Lord had put them into a deep sleep.
6. This king had a dream in which God said to him "You are a dead man." Who was he?

Answer: Abimelek

The story is found in Genesis 20. God warned Abimelek in dreams that the woman he had taken, Sarah, was already married.
7. Eutychus fell from a third-story window when he went to sleep while listening to Peter preach. True or false?

Answer: False

False. Eutychus did fall, but Paul was the one preaching. Paul was also the one who brought him back to life afterward. See Acts 20:9.
8. This poor guy dreamt about baskets, bread, and birds; too bad it meant that in three days he would be dead. Who was he?

Answer: Chief baker

See Genesis 40:16-20. After hearing the interpretation of the cupbearer's dream the baker was really happy to tell Joseph his dream; however, the interpretation was quite different and not as joyful.
9. While he slept peacefully after a heavy battle. this tired soldier was killed with a tent peg through his temple. Who was he?

Answer: Sisera

Judges 4:21 tells the story of how Sisera was killed by a woman while he slept after losing a battle with the Israelites.
10. A man was telling a friend his dream about a loaf of barley that knocked down a tent and made it collapse. Who just happened to be listening to the telling of the dream and its interpretation?

Answer: Gideon

Before attacking the Midianites Gideon went down to their camp. He arrived at the right moment to hear the dream that was a foretelling of his victory over the Midianites. The story is found in Judges 7.
